Comparison of Energy-Saving Laser Diodes with Imported Brands

Energy-saving laser diodes offer comparable efficiency and reliability to imported brands, with potential advantages in cost and local support, but imported brands often lead in high-power performance and advanced packaging.

Efficiency and Energy Consumption

Energy-saving laser diodes are designed to minimize electrical power consumption while maintaining optical output, often through optimized semiconductor materials and thermal management. Imported brands, particularly from leading global manufacturers, also provide high-efficiency diodes, but may focus on high-power or specialized applications where energy efficiency is secondary to output performance . Both types convert electrical energy directly into coherent light, but energy-saving models emphasize lower threshold currents and reduced heat generation, which can improve operational efficiency and reduce cooling requirements .

Output Power and Beam Quality

Imported brands often offer broad-area diode bars and diode stacks capable of delivering hundreds to thousands of watts, suitable for industrial laser processing, whereas energy-saving domestic diodes typically focus on single emitters or low-power bars with high brightness and diffraction-limited beams . While imported high-power diodes may sacrifice beam quality for wattage, energy-saving diodes often maintain narrow linewidths and stable single-mode operation, which is advantageous for precision applications like spectroscopy or fiber coupling .

Packaging and Integration

Imported brands frequently provide advanced packaging options, such as butterfly packages with integrated thermoelectric coolers (TEC) and fiber pigtails, ensuring stable wavelength and temperature control . Energy-saving laser diodes may use simpler TO-can or C-mount packages, which are cost-effective and easier to integrate but may require additional thermal management for high-power applications . Both types can be fiber-coupled, but imported brands often offer polarization-maintaining fibers and wavelength-stabilized designs for telecom and sensing applications .

Cost and Support

Energy-saving laser diodes are generally more affordable, with direct access to local technical support and faster delivery times, reducing total cost of ownership . Imported brands, while often more expensive, provide extensive global support, longer track records, and advanced warranty options, which can be critical for high-reliability or mission-critical applications .

Applications

  • Energy-saving diodes: Ideal for low- to medium-power industrial processing, medical therapy, sensing, and fiber-optic communication where efficiency and cost are priorities .
  • Imported brands: Preferred for high-power laser processing, precision spectroscopy, telecom, and research applications requiring high stability, narrow linewidth, and advanced packaging .

Summary

Energy-saving laser diodes provide competitive efficiency, lower operational costs, and easier local support, making them suitable for many industrial and commercial applications. Imported brands excel in high-power output, advanced packaging, and specialized performance, which may justify higher costs for demanding applications. The choice depends on power requirements, beam quality, integration complexity, and budget constraints .
